CYS Program Associate Technology Lab NF-03

4 months ago


Fort Shafter, United States Department Of The Army Full time
Summary

This position is located at Middle School & Teen Center, Schofield Barracks. Management has the right to assign staff to locations as mission requires.

This position is a Regular Part-Time position with a minimum work week of 20 hours and eligible for benefits/leave accrual.

This position is entitled to 8.9% COLA (Island of Oahu). COLA is subject to change without notice.

DoD approved commissary privileges to CYS employees. This temporary approval expires 31 Dec 2024.



Duties
  • Responsible for the operation of the Child and Youth Services (CYS) Technology Lab in accordance with applicable regulations. Plans, coordinates, and conducts activities for program participants.
  • Creates a positive environment in CYS Technology Lab that includes appropriate materials and supplies to supplement computer software programs and Internet access. Provides supervision, oversight, and accountability for program participants.
  • Ensures computer, peripherals, and software are maintained in good condition and working order. Troubleshoots CYS hardware, printers, scanners, servers and software.
  • Interacts with children and youth using approved child guidance and youth development techniques. Promotes and role models safety, fitness, health and nutrition practices.
  • Trains children/youth in use of equipment and software programs. Ensures assigned area achieves and maintains standards for DoD/Army certification and national accreditation or Army equivalent.
